What is quality loss in lossy compression?
Quality loss in lossy compression refers to the reduction in audio or image quality that occurs when data is compressed to save space.
Can you explain how lossy compression works?
Sure! Lossy compression reduces file size by removing some data, which can lead to a loss of quality that may not be noticeable to the average user.
What are some common examples of lossy compression formats?
Common examples include JPEG for images and MP3 for audio. Both formats significantly reduce file size while sacrificing some quality.
Is there a way to minimize quality loss in lossy compression?
Yes, using higher bit rates during compression can help minimize quality loss, but it will result in larger file sizes.
